The Corner

A Poem by Pastel Nix

Sometimes I sit alone my room.
Just me and my thoughts.
And there's this corner.
It's not a special corner.
Just a plain, white corner.
This corner just sits there.
It never does anything special.
One day, I looked at that plain, white corner.
And in that corner, sat a spider.
It wasn't a big spider.
The spider was quite small.
But this tiny spider made a web,
In this normal corner.
This tiny spider made a home,
Out of a simple corner that does nothing.
The corner isn't very special to me.
But to this little spider,
This corner is very special.
